1. Demographic Trends

One of the fundamental aspects of real estate analysis is understanding the demographic trends in a given area. This includes population growth, age distribution, income levels, and employment opportunities. Cities and regions experiencing population growth tend to have a higher demand for housing, making them attractive markets for real estate investments.

Furthermore, paying attention to factors like average household size, education levels, and family structure can provide insights into the types of properties that are in demand. For instance, a growing population of young professionals might create a need for affordable apartments or condos, while areas with a higher number of families may require larger single-family homes.

2. Economic Indicators

The state of the local economy has a direct impact on the real estate market. Factors such as employment rates, GDP growth, and industry diversification play a crucial role. A healthy job market and a diverse economy can contribute to a stable and growing real estate market.

Additionally, examining trends in median household income can help identify the purchasing power of potential buyers. Areas with rising incomes may see increased demand for higher-end properties, while regions with lower median incomes may have a greater demand for affordable housing options.

3. Housing Supply and Demand

The balance between housing supply and demand is a key driver of property values. In areas where demand exceeds supply, property prices tend to rise, creating potential investment opportunities. Conversely, an oversupply of housing can lead to stagnation or even a decline in property values.

Analyzing metrics like months of inventory (MOI) and absorption rate can provide insights into the balance between supply and demand in a specific area. A low MOI indicates a seller’s market, while a high MOI suggests a buyer’s market.

4. Local Infrastructure and Amenities

Access to essential amenities and quality infrastructure can significantly impact property values. Proximity to schools, healthcare facilities, shopping centers, parks, and public transportation are all factors that potential buyers and tenants consider.

Furthermore, areas with planned or ongoing infrastructure projects, such as new highways, public transportation expansions, or commercial developments, may experience an increase in property values over time.

5. Regulatory Environment

Understanding the local zoning laws, building codes, and land use regulations is crucial for any real estate investor or developer. These regulations can influence the type of properties that can be built, as well as the potential for future development or redevelopment in a given area.

Additionally, keeping an eye on any proposed or upcoming regulatory changes can provide valuable insights into the future of the real estate market in a specific region.
